The meeting was well attended with most user groups represented as well as members of the development trust, our hard working MSP Ailleen Campbell and many others who simply want to retain the hall. No local councillors attended - no surprise there. It was decided unanimously that we should do what we can to retain the Jub as an independant community asset, and as such a volunteer group was set up to pursue this aim.

South Lanarkshire Council have previously said there will be no extension to the November closure date and pserrure will be put on them to transfer this much needed asset to the community.
